B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-quality use and tested to fulfill stringent high-quality and protection benchmarks. BHT is a lipophilic natural and organic compound that may be generally applied being an antioxidant in different industrial applications. In animal nourishment, BHT FEED GRADE TEST is commonly utilised to avoid the oxidation of fats and oils in animal feed, thereby preserving the nutritional benefit and lengthening the shelf life of the feed. Oxidized fats don't just get rid of nutritional efficacy but also can create destructive compounds, impacting the wellness and development of livestock. The inclusion of BHT in feed necessitates demanding tests to ensure it adheres to regulatory criteria and is also safe for intake by animals, which ultimately enters the human food stuff chain. The testing protocols typically assess the purity, efficacy, and potential residues in animal tissues.
One more important compound from the chemical area is Pentachloropyridine. This compound is actually a chlorinated spinoff of pyridine and it has garnered interest resulting from its utility being an intermediate inside the synthesis of agrochemicals, dyes, and prescribed drugs. Its high degree of chlorination causes it to be a powerful compound, which must be managed with treatment because of potential toxicity and environmental considerations. Pentachloropyridine serves for a building block in chemical synthesis, letting chemists to create more elaborate molecules That could be Utilized in herbicides, insecticides, or maybe specialty polymers. The dealing with and disposal of Pentachloropyridine are controlled, offered its likely environmental persistence and bioaccumulation possibility. Industries working with this compound often undertake shut-procedure output methods and arduous protection protocols to attenuate publicity.
M-Phenylene Diamine, frequently abbreviated as MPD, is really an aromatic amine that options prominently from the manufacture of aramid fibers, which might be very well-recognized for their heat resistance and toughness. Kevlar and Nomex, Utilized in physique armor and fire-resistant outfits, respectively, are developed employing MPD as being a key precursor. The compound alone is made up of a benzene ring with two amino groups from the meta positions, which makes it suitable for building polymers with appealing thermal and mechanical Homes. M-Phenylene Diamine (MPD) is usually Utilized in the dye industry, specially in hair dyes together with other cosmetic apps, Even though its use has long been curtailed in some areas because of basic safety issues. When production products that contains MPD, good occupational security techniques are essential to safeguard personnel from extended exposure, which could lead to skin sensitization or other health concerns.
O-Phenylene Diamine (OPDA), whilst structurally much like MPD, differs from the positioning of the amino groups, which drastically influences its chemical reactivity and software. OPDA is commonly used within the production of dyes and pigments, the place it contributes to your development of vivid hues that are stable and lengthy-lasting. Additionally it is Utilized in the synthesis of heterocyclic compounds and prescribed drugs. OPDA’s position in corrosion inhibitors and rubber chemical compounds even further highlights its flexibility. Having said that, comparable to other aromatic amines, OPDA is usually associated with toxicity risks, and so, its use is diligently managed and monitored. The value of proper dealing with, proper storage, and sufficient protecting actions can't be overstated when coping with OPDA in almost any industrial placing.
Pinacolone is an additional noteworthy compound with a number of purposes. It is just a ketone Together with the molecular formulation C6H12O and is made use of principally as an intermediate during the synthesis of pesticides and herbicides, specially inside the creation of triazole fungicides and selected plant development regulators. Pinacolone’s composition includes a tertiary butyl team, which contributes to its distinctive reactivity in natural and organic synthesis. Past agriculture, it will also be present in the manufacture of prescription drugs and fragrances. Pinacolone is valued for its capability to bear nucleophilic substitution and condensation reactions, making it a worthwhile reagent in laboratory and industrial procedures. Although it is actually significantly less harmful than a few of the Earlier discussed compounds, security safeguards remain necessary to mitigate any hazards affiliated with its volatility and possible irritant Homes.
two-Heptanone is a ketone that By natural means happens in a few vegetation and is usually found in little quantities in human sweat and specific animal secretions. It is often Utilized in the fragrance and taste industries resulting from its enjoyable, fruity odor. Additionally, 2-Heptanone has found applications as being a solvent and intermediate in natural synthesis. Interestingly, analysis has advised that it might Engage in a role in chemical signaling, especially in insects, in which it acts being an alarm pheromone. This has brought about its review in pest Regulate tactics and behavioral science. Industrially, 2-Heptanone is synthesized for use 2-Heptanone in coatings, adhesives, and cleaners. Its relatively low toxicity can make it suited to use in client items, Though suitable labeling and managing Recommendations are often mandated.
